Yield: 8–10 Slices

Lemon Blueberry Layer Cake – Light, Fluffy and Delicious

This Lemon Blueberry Layer Cake – Light, Fluffy and Delicious is bright, airy, and bursting with fresh flavor. Soft vanilla-lemon cake layers are filled with juicy blueberries and paired with a smooth, creamy frosting that brings everything together beautifully.

Prep Time 25 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es

Ingredients

  • For the Cake:
  • 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 ½ teaspoons ba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¾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 ¾ cups gran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 tablespoon lemon zest
  • ¼ cup fresh l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1 ½ cups fresh blueberries (tossed with 1 tablespoon flour)
  • For the Lemon Frosting:
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 3 cups pow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on lemon zest
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

1. Preheat Oven

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and line two 8-inch cake pans.

2. Mix Dry Ingredients

In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t.

3. Make Cake Batter

In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
Add eggs one at a time, mixing well.
Stir in lemon zest, lemon juice, and vanilla extract.
Alternate adding dry ingredients and milk, mixing until smooth.

4. Add Blueberries

Gently fold in flour-coated blueberries to prevent sinking.

5. Bake

Divide batter evenly between pans.
Bake for 30–35 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ean.
Let cool completely before frosting.

6. Make Frosting

Beat cream cheese and butter until smooth.
Add powdered sugar, lemon juice, lemon zest, and vanilla. Beat until fluffy.

7. Assemble Cake

Spread frosting between layers and over the top of the cake. Decorate with extra blueberries if desired.

Notes

  • Extra Moist Cake: Do not overmix the batter.
  • Frozen Blueberries: Can be used (do not thaw first).
  • Stronger Lemon Flavor: Add extra lemon zest to both cake and frosting.
  • Storage: Store covered in the refrigerator up to 4 days.
  • Make Ahead: Cake layers can be baked a day in advance.
